// ExtendSessionExpiryIfNeeded extends Session.ExpiresAt based on session lengths in config.
|
|
// A new ExpiresAt is only written if enough time has elapsed since last update.
|
|
// Returns true only if the session was extended.
|
|
func (a *App) ExtendSessionExpiryIfNeeded(session *model.Session) bool {
|
|
if !*a.Srv().Config().ServiceSettings.ExtendSessionLengthWithActivity {
|
|
return false
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if session == nil || session.IsExpired() {
|
|
return false
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
sessionLength := a.GetSessionLengthInMillis(session)
|
|
|
|
// Only extend the expiry if the lessor of 1% or 1 day has elapsed within the
|
|
// current session duration.
|
|
threshold := int64(math.Min(float64(sessionLength)*0.01, float64(24*60*60*1000)))
|
|
// Minimum session length is 1 day as of this writing, therefore a minimum ~14 minutes threshold.
|
|
// However we'll add a sanity check here in case that changes. Minimum 5 minute threshold,
|
|
// meaning we won't write a new expiry more than every 5 minutes.
|
|
if threshold < 5*60*1000 {
|
|
threshold = 5 * 60 * 1000
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
now := model.GetMillis()
|
|
elapsed := now - (session.ExpiresAt - sessionLength)
|
|
if elapsed < threshold {
|
|
return false
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
auditRec := a.MakeAuditRecord("extendSessionExpiry", audit.Fail)
|
|
defer a.LogAuditRec(auditRec, nil)
|
|
auditRec.AddMeta("session", session)
|
|
|
|
newExpiry := now + sessionLength
|
|
if err := a.Srv().Store.Session().UpdateExpiresAt(session.Id, newExpiry); err != nil {
|
|
mlog.Error("Failed to update ExpiresAt", mlog.String("user_id", session.UserId), mlog.String("session_id", session.Id), mlog.Err(err))
|
|
auditRec.AddMeta("err", err.Error())
|
|
return false
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Update local cache. No need to invalidate cache for cluster as the session cache timeout
|
|
// ensures each node will get an extended expiry within the next 10 minutes.
|
|
// Worst case is another node may generate a redundant expiry update.
|
|
session.ExpiresAt = newExpiry
|
|
a.srv.userService.AddSessionToCache(session)
|
|
|
|
mlog.Debug("Session extended", mlog.String("user_id", session.UserId), mlog.String("session_id", session.Id),
|
|
mlog.Int64("newExpiry", newExpiry), mlog.Int64("session_length", sessionLength))
|
|
|
|
auditRec.Success()
|
|
auditRec.AddMeta("extended_session", session)
|
|
return true
|
|
}
